2003~2007年湘江长沙段洲滩钉螺分布调查

摘    要:目的全面了解湘江长沙段各洲滩钉螺的分布现状和数量变化,考核近年来的灭螺效果。方法采用系统抽样结合环境抽查的方法,对湘江长沙段洲滩进行连续5年的螺情调查。结果2003~2007年跟踪调查24个洲滩,结果有螺洲滩数分别为当年调查洲滩的77.8%、66.7%、70.8%、75.0%和62.5%,5年共查出有螺洲滩20个,占洲滩总数的83.3%。湘江长沙段各洲滩有螺框出现率、活螺率不相同,但下降趋势明显(P均〈0.01);药物与环改灭螺相结合的效果远好于单纯的药物灭螺。结论湘江长沙段洲滩的螺情得到了较好的控制。

Distribution of Oncomelania snails in marshland of Changsha section of Xiang River,2003-2007

Abstract:Objective To investigate the distribution and quantitative changes in each marshland of Cbangsba section of the Xiang River and evaluate the effectiveness of snail control in recent years. Methods A snail survey was carried out by using the systematic and environmental sampling method for 5 years. Results Twenty-four marshlands were investigated continuously from 2003 to 2007. The number of marsbland with snails accounted for 77.8%, 66.7%, 70.8%, 75. 0% and 62.5% of the each investigated year, respectively. The total number of marsblands with snails were 20 that accounted for 83.3 % of all marshlands investigated over the five years. The number of snails and the rate of living snails were different in each marsbland, but the downward trend was significant (P〈0. 01). The combination of environment improvement and molluscicides for snail control was much more effective than only the latter. Conclusion The Oncomelania snails in the Cbangsba section of the Xiang River are well controlled.
